When and why did you begin to produce music?
I think it all started in 1999. I was just a 9-year-old kid and I was struck by an old TV in a small shop that was playing the video clip of "Blue (Da Ba Dee)" by Eiffel 65. I was hypnotized. I had a thousand feelings inside me... which were definitely the reasons that pushed me to get closer to music...
I didn't know how, when and in what way... but I already had the awareness that music would be my life companion in the years to come. I listened to music every day. I listened to the radio a lot. Sometimes it happened that I didn't want to get out of my uncle's car... because I wanted to continue listening to Albertino on Radio Deejay.
While I was listening... I tried to reproduce the individual sounds with my mouth... I managed to recreate kick and bass, or synth melodies... using only my mouth and my imagination... I was just a 9-year-old kid, I didn't even know what a sequencer was.
In the years that followed, curiosity pushed me more and more towards this world and so at the age of 12 I started secretly using my father's PC, with the first sequencer.

At 13, my first experiences as a DJ in friends' garages with "consoles" and very artisanal instruments! Laughing out loud Every time I approached music, a magic was created... a bit like when you make love to the person you have fallen madly in love with... and it’s still like that today. I still make love with music... So I chose to start producing music first and foremost for personal well-being (for me, music is a natural medicine).
Consequently, because I always hope to create well-being for other people too... there’s nothing more beautiful in this world than leaving a trace of yourself to people who appreciate your works. This is the true nature of art.

What do you think is the future for Italo Dance music?
Looking at the present... I imagine a positive future for Italian dance music. Unfortunately, the Italian discography is not very well managed and in the last 20 years it has not given much visibility to the dance genre, apart from some very rare cases. But despite this, fortunately many international mainstream artists are returning to typical sounds of the golden age of dance and in those years most of the hits were produced by Italians.
Specifically, I think that Italo Dance has never disappeared... but that it has only evolved.

"...nothing is created, nothing is lost, everything changes." (Lavoisier)

What are your plans for the future? style, project etc.
I have always experimented in music. From this point of view I’m a rebel! Laughing out loud I don't always follow rules and I like to mix different styles and different sounds.
Musical research is fundamental in the creative phase and also allows you to be original.
In recent years with the Siculand project I have moved towards SlowStyle, SynthPop, Psy-Trance, Folk Music and many other styles. Siculand allows me to express myself, without constraints, without deadlines and without discographic compromises. Pure Art and Creativity. So I only create something when I am truly inspired.
I think that if you want to tell your emotion in music you have to do it in the most natural way possible and for this reason each song has its own dress... because it’s born in that way... then later on other visions/versions can certainly be born over time.

In these years I have often received private messages from followers and fans of Siculand. Many ask me to go back to doing italodance. However I have never abandoned italodance. I have several unreleased demos and remixes with this style... They will arrive... everything will happen naturally, as it should be.

Here... I can certainly say that among my projects and plans. There are several purely Italo Dance productions with Siculand... and I sense a great desire for ITALO DANCE in the air! Smile
